February
In February, Union is pretty cool and somewhat rainy. Temperatures routinely are in the high 30s F (single digits C) and a bit less than half of the time jump into the low 40s F (single digits C) range. At night, lows are in the 10s F (single digits below 0 C). This is also a rainy time for Union, with several of the days of the month having rain. In February, humidity reaches as high as 60%.

March
In March, Union is pretty cool and somewhat rainy. Temperatures routinely are in the 40s F (single digits C) and about a third of the time jump into the low 50s F (single digits C) range. At night, lows are in the low 20s F (single digits below 0 C). This is also a rainy time for Union, with several of the days of the month having rain. In March, humidity reaches as high as 60%.

June
If you visit Union during June, you will probably notice that it is warm and somewhat rainy. Temperatures tend to hover around the high 70s F (mid 20s C) during the day, while at night they can dip into the 50s F (low 10s C). Humidity is generally between 50 and 60% during the day. In terms of precipitation, you can expect it to rain about a third of the time.

What to do in Union, Connecticut, United States of America
Union, Connecticut is a small town located in northeastern Connecticut, and is home to numerous picturesque natural landscapes, historical sites, and cultural attractions that draw in countless visitors throughout the year. Whether you're an outdoor enthusiast, history buff, or traveling with your family, Union has something to offer everyone. Here are some of the top tourist attractions in Union, Connecticut, that you definitely shouldn't miss.
1. Bigelow Hollow State Park: This park comprises a magnificent area of over 9,000 acres that is home to several natural attractions, including the Nipmuck State Forest, Bigelow Pond, and the aptly named "Swamp Island" Pond. Bigelow Hollow State Park offers scenic trails for hiking, mountain biking, and horseback riding, as well as opportunities for fishing, picnicking, and camping amidst some breathtaking wilderness.
2. Mashapaug Lake: Known as one of the most pristine bodies of water in the state, Mashapaug Lake is a popular spot for diving and recreational boating. You can also enjoy either swimming or sunbathing at the lake's designated beach area. Additionally, the Mashapaug Lake Dam offers excellent views of the area, attracting photographers and nature enthusiasts alike.
3. Old Furnace State Park: This park is named after a nearby 19 th-century iron furnace and is one of the Connecticut's most photogenic locations. Visitors can explore the historic ruins of the furnace, take a scenic walk through the serene forests of the park, or have a picnic in the park's charming pavilion.
4. Union General Store: The Union General Store is a building that dates back to 1790 and is one of the oldest continuously operated stores in the United States. The store still retains its rustic charm, selling handcrafted goods and artisanal wares. If you're looking for some wholesome American charm, the Union General Store is always a fun and fascinating stop.
5. The Traveler Restaurant: This restaurant is a famous place in Union, thanks to the fact that everyone who visits the establishment receives complimentary reading material with their meal - travelers can take their choice of a book from the restaurant's vast library, with the option to keep it at home or bring it back as a loan next time they dine. The Traveler Restaurant is a perfect combination of food, amusement, and culture, perfect for those looking for a unique dining experience.
6. The Museum of American Political Life: This museum chronicles the history of American political life, and conserves and interprets significant artifacts and information about the evolution of the American political process. It's a fascinating place for history buffs and anyone interested in the American political system, with a wide range of exhibits and displays that provide insight into key moments of the country's history.
